Located in the historic center of the city of Grosseto, the Museum of Natural History of the Maremma (formerly the Museum of Natural History of Grosseto) covers three floors: two exhibition and one dedicated to the museum activities.

The Museum presents itself as a cultural center and a place for dialogue between the scientific community and the public, by means of guided tours, educational activities, special projects, exhibitions, conferences, conventions, ... The articulation of the rooms is based on two main styles: a more "classical" treatment, inspired by the systematic or chronological criteria (in line with the most common logic in the abiotic samples exposure) and a descriptive approach of habitats and their ecological relationships. In both cases, the exhibits are released from a static context and given a more modern and communicative dimension. The simultaneous use of different display types (panels, showcases, dioramas, multimedia workstations) results in a communicative model complex, differentiated by subject and type of user.

Along the exhibition are often alternated detailed information on the exposed samples and analysis on topics of general interest. This allows you to simultaneously create an exhaustive treatment of the reality of their specific environmental context, without giving the description of general topics, often preparatory to the correct understanding of other concepts.

A further cornerstone of the museum are the training islands, important support elements and depth to the simple guided tour. These are spaces physically distinct from the exhibition structures, within which students can attend lectures on specific topics and develop direct experience, through the manipulation of samples. The additional classes are well positioned next to a guided tour of the exhibition rooms or constitute an independent teaching tool, placed in the context of a thematic course of study. Structure and location of the training islands not impede the normal use of the tour, allowing the simultaneous pursuit of educational activities and visits (with or without guide).
